Eligibility

Inclusion criteria

Inclusion criteria: School children aged from 11 to 17 years. Both boys and girls. Children who provided parental written permission. Students who provided written assent.

Exclusion criteria

Exclusion criteria: School children with congenital deformities. School children with congenital musculoskeletal disorders. Recent (3 months ) musculoskeletal injuries . Skin abrasion near the knee joint. Exclude any painful condition that affects joint movements. Children with poor cognition or unable to follow the instructions given by the data collector. Children with visual, hearing, and speech impairment

Design outcomes

Primary

MeasureTime frame
Prevalence of joint hypermobility among school children aged 11-17 years, assessed using the beighton score.Timepoint: 2 weeks
